Avoiding Common Mistakes with Pythagoras’ Theorem

Pythagoras’ Theorem is a staple of GCSE Maths, especially at Higher level, but students often lose marks through avoidable errors. Whether it’s mixing up sides, misapplying the formula, or forgetting to square root, these mistakes can be costly. Below, we highlight some of the most frequent errors and show the correct approach in a handy table.

Common ErrorIncorrect TechniqueCorrect Technique
Mixing up hypotenuse and shorter sidesAdding the two shorter sides without squaring: c = a + bUse the correct formula:
c^2 = a^2 + b^2
then c = \sqrt{a^2 + b^2}
Forgetting to square rootLeaving the answer as c^2:
c^2 = 25
c = 25
Take the square root:
c^2 = 25
c = 5
Using the wrong formula for shorter sideAdding instead of subtracting:
a^2 = b^2 + c^2
Subtract to find a shorter side:
a^2 = c^2 - b^2
Applying to non-right-angled trianglesUsing Pythagoras for any triangleOnly use Pythagoras for right-angled triangles
Rounding too earlyRounding intermediate answers before the final stepKeep full accuracy until the final answer, then round
Ignoring unitsGiving a numerical answer without unitsAlways include correct units (e.g., cm, m) in your answer

Quick Tips:

  • Always identify the hypotenuse (the side opposite the right angle).
  • Double-check that the triangle is right-angled before applying the theorem.
  • Write out the full formula and substitute values carefully.
  • Only round your answer at the very end.
